[發明專利]基于ADS-B數據預測航班落地時間的方法在審
| 申請號: | 201910639959.2 | 申請日: | 2019-07-16 |
| 公開(公告)號: | CN110443411A | 公開(公告)日: | 2019-11-12 |
| 發明(設計)人: | 劉曉疆;戰嘉馨;陳曉;孫龍濤;陳宇;劉青;李坤 | 申請(專利權)人: | 青島民航凱亞系統集成有限公司 |
| 主分類號: | G06Q10/04 | 分類號: | G06Q10/04;G06Q50/30;G06F16/2458;G06N3/04;G06N3/08 |
| 代理公司: | 青島中天匯智知識產權代理有限公司 37241 | 代理人: | 郝團代 |
| 地址: | 266000 山東*** | 國省代碼: | 山東;37 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 航班 落地 預測 神經網絡預測模型 實時位置數據 信息服務內容 持續接收 調控能力 接收設備 頻率輸出 數據預測 預測結果 預測模型 整體資源 精細化 更新 機場 管理 | ||
1.一種基于ADS-B數據預測航班落地時間的方法,其特征在于:當航班進入ADS-B接收設備的接收范圍后,持續接收到的航班ADS-B數據由預測模型計算,按一定頻率輸出預測結果直至航班落地;
包括以下實施步驟,
步驟1數據處理
1)ADS-B數據接收
使用多臺ADS-B接收設備,對不同方向、角度、高度的航班發送的ADS-B數據進行接收,數據實時匯集到統一的數據中心并去重;
2)ADS-B數據過濾與解析
ADS-B接收設備將數據通過UDP協議轉發至接收模塊,接收模塊進行UDP解包得到明文字符串:
對上述字符串進行解析,解析后的字段存入數據庫;
步驟2預測計算
解析后的ADS-B數據送入預測模塊,采用神經網絡模型做為預測模型以實時地計算每條ADS-B數據對應航班的預計落地時間,唯一的輸出值即為預測的航班落地時間;
通過神經網絡模型得到的預測時間,是去除輸出層該節點神經元的激活函數后,直接輸出上一層節點加權求和的值;
步驟3結果備查
當前航班落地時間的預測值,連續地推送至消息隊列并更新;
或是,由信息查詢模塊提供后臺查詢服務,即緩存每條ADS-B數據對應航班的預計落地時間、并提供對外查詢接口。
2.根據權利要求1所述的基于ADS-B數據預測航班落地時間的方法,其特征在于:所述ADS-B接收設備的接收范圍是,地域范圍以機場為中心,經度上下5度,維度上下5度,以機場為圓心、半徑為200-300千米的圓。
3.根據權利要求1或2所述的基于ADS-B數據預測航班落地時間的方法,其特征在于:所述的神經網絡模型包括輸入層、隱藏層和輸出層結構;
隱藏層為多層結構;
隱藏層與輸出層的每個節點都是一個神經元,每個神經元有多個輸入,每個輸入值經過權值計算并經過非線性的激活函數得到唯一輸出;
中間層的神經元采用Relu函數作為激活函數。
4.根據權利要求3所述的基于ADS-B數據預測航班落地時間的方法,其特征在于:所述的預測模型按如下步驟進行確定;
⑴、數據提取
采用某機場多條歷史ADS-B數據與歷史航班的關聯數據做為數據集;
取ADS-B數據的經度、緯度、高度三個值作為訓練特征,取歷史航班數據中航班實際落地時間與ADS-B數據的接收時間的差作為訓練目標;
⑵、回歸模型選取
選用神經網絡模型;
⑶、損失函數選擇
選用均方誤差作為神經網絡模型的損失函數;
均方誤差損失函數的公式如下:
⑷、效果驗證
使用keras框架的神經網絡模型進行訓練,用得到的模型對某機場數天內所有進港航班進行了落地時間預測;
⑸、模型封裝
將訓練好的神經網絡模型以.pb文件保存。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于青島民航凱亞系統集成有限公司,未經青島民航凱亞系統集成有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201910639959.2/1.html,轉載請聲明來源鉆瓜專利網。
- 同類專利
- 專利分類
G06Q 專門適用于行政、商業、金融、管理、監督或預測目的的數據處理系統或方法;其他類目不包含的專門適用于行政、商業、金融、管理、監督或預測目的的處理系統或方法
G06Q10-00 行政;管理
G06Q10-02 .預定,例如用于門票、服務或事件的
G06Q10-04 .預測或優化,例如線性規劃、“旅行商問題”或“下料問題”
G06Q10-06 .資源、工作流、人員或項目管理,例如組織、規劃、調度或分配時間、人員或機器資源;企業規劃;組織模型
G06Q10-08 .物流,例如倉儲、裝貨、配送或運輸;存貨或庫存管理,例如訂貨、采購或平衡訂單
G06Q10-10 .辦公自動化,例如電子郵件或群件的計算機輔助管理





